This Victorian gents' umbrella has a rustic treen burl/burr handle. The burl has been skilfully hand-carved into the shape of a man's head with original sharp glass eyes wearing a top hat. Below the handle is an ornate black cord tassel and a brass collar.
''A burl (American English) or burr (British English) is a tree growth in which the grain has grown in a deformed manner. It is commonly found in the form of a rounded outgrowth on a tree trunk or branch that is filled with small knots from dormant buds. Burl formation is typically a result of some form of stress. Burls yield a very peculiar and highly figured wood sought after in woodworking, and some items may reach high prices on the wood market.'

There is a metal shaft and frame that holds an original black silk canopy with a maker's stamp to one of the spokes:
'Paragon Patent No. 420709
S. Fox & Co.
Made In England'

For the renowned umbrella frame makers:
'Samuel Fox & Co'
‘It was in 1848 that Samuel Fox, a wire drawer by trade, started to make solid steel ribs in Stocksbridge, near Sheffield.
Fox was a master wire drawer and it was this skill in the production of fine-quality wire that he turned to the production of umbrella ribs.
Samuel Fox continued improving and developing his ribs over the next few years when his son William Henry Fox joined the company around 1913 and around this time adopted the trademark 'Paragon'.’
